OCUK spurs production of LG ultra-wide 1440p monitor

If you are in the market for an ultra-wide 21:9 monitor then Overclockers UK has you covered as the retailer will be exclusively selling the LG 34UC97-P 34 Inch 3440×1440 curved LED monitor for the next few months. Originally, LG didn't plan to bring this monitor to the UK but OCUK purchasing manager, Andrew ‘Gibbo' Gibson, managed to convince them otherwise.

The screen has a 21:9 aspect ratio and a resolution of 3440×1440, showing 2.4 times more visual information at one time than a regular 1920×1080 monitor. Additionally, LG decided to go with an 8-bit +FRC  IPS panel, allowing for a 99 per cent sRGB color gamut rating. Due to the IPS panel, there is a slightly slower 5ms response time, rather than the 1ms response time you would find on a TN monitor, although the color benefits of IPS often outweigh this.

The curved display nearly encompasses 180 degrees, allowing the user to cover nearly all of their peripheral vision, bringing users a new gaming and media experience. For connectivity, the screen has two HDMI ports, one DisplayPort connection and two Thunderbolt ports. There's also two USB 3.0 ports and some built-in speakers, which promise “deeper bass and crystal clear highs” with MaxxAudio technology.

This monitor will set buyers back £979.99 and won't be sold anywhere else in the UK until 2015.
